What Are Peptide Hormones?

Peptide hormones are a fundamental category of hormones characterized by their molecular structure: they are made from amino acids linked together in a polypeptide chain. This structure differentiates them from steroid hormones, which are derived from cholesterol. These molecules are synthesized by specialized endocrine glands or cells and released into the bloodstream to act as signaling molecules, binding to specific receptors on target cells to elicit a response.

Examples of well-known peptide hormones include insulin, which regulates blood sugar; glucagon, also involved in glucose metabolism; oxytocin, associated with social bonding and reproduction; and vasopressin, which controls water balance. Growth hormone, crucial for growth and development, is another significant peptide hormone.

The mechanism of action for peptide hormones typically involves binding to receptors on the cell surface. This binding triggers a cascade of intracellular events, often mediated by secondary messengers, leading to rapid, short-term adjustments in cellular activity. Peptide Therapy and Hormone Optimization

The therapeutic potential of peptides has gained significant attention, particularly in the realm of hormone optimization and anti-aging. Peptide therapy involves the administration of specific peptides designed to stimulate the body's natural healing and regulatory mechanisms, or to influence hormone production and release. For instance, certain peptides are known to stimulate the production of growth hormone, which plays a vital role in muscle growth, recovery, and metabolic functionPeptide hormones - Department of Diabetes, Endocrinology ....

While HRT directly introduces hormones to supplement declining levels, peptide therapy often aims to signal the body to produce or better regulate its own hormones. Many wellness programs integrate both approaches, using hormone replacement to restore foundational balance while peptides support specific functions or enhance the body's natural processes.
